男性中KIAA2022致病变异的临床谱:两名携带KIAA2022致病变异男孩的病例报告及文献复习

Clinical spectrum of KIAA2022 pathogenic variants in males: Case report of two boys with KIAA2022 pathogenic variants and review of the literature.

Abstract

KIAA2022 is an X-linked intellectual disability (XLID) syndrome affecting males more severely than females. Few males with KIAA2022 variants and XLID have been reported. We present a clinical report of two unrelated males, with two nonsense KIAA2022 pathogenic variants, with profound intellectual disabilities, limited language development, strikingly similar autistic behavior, delay in motor milestones, and postnatal growth restriction. Patient 1, 19-years-old, has long ears, deeply set eyes with keratoconus, strabismus, a narrow forehead, anteverted nares, café-au-lait spots, macroglossia, thick vermilion of the upper and lower lips, and prognathism. He has gastroesophageal reflux, constipation with delayed rectosigmoid colonic transit time, difficulty regulating temperature, several musculoskeletal issues, and a history of one grand mal seizure. Patient 2, 10-years-old, has mild dysmorphic features, therapy resistant vomiting with diminished motility of the stomach, mild constipation, cortical visual impairment with intermittent strabismus, axial hypotonia, difficulty regulating temperature, and cutaneous mastocytosis. Genetic testing identified KIAA2022 variant c.652C > T(p.Arg218*) in Patient 1, and a novel nonsense de novo variant c.2707G > T(p.Glu903*) in Patient 2. We also summarized features of all reported males with KIAA2022 variants to date. This report not only adds knowledge of a novel pathogenic variant to the KIAA2022 variant database, but also likely extends the spectrum by describing novel dysmorphic features and medical conditions including macroglossia, café-au-lait spots, keratoconus, severe cutaneous mastocytosis, and motility problems of the GI tract, which may help physicians involved in the care of patients with this syndrome. Lastly, we describe the power of social media in bringing families with rare medical conditions together.

摘要

KIAA2022是一种X连锁智力障碍(XLID)综合征,对男性的影响比对女性更为严重。报道的携带KIAA2022变异和XLID的男性很少。我们报告了两名无亲缘关系的男性的临床病例,他们携带两个KIAA2022致病性无义变异,患有严重智力障碍、语言发育受限、自闭症行为极为相似、运动发育里程碑延迟以及出生后生长受限。患者1,19岁,耳朵长,眼睛深陷且有圆锥角膜、斜视,额头狭窄,鼻孔前倾,咖啡斑,巨舌,上下唇朱红色增厚,以及凸颌。他有胃食管反流、便秘且直肠乙状结肠运输时间延迟、体温调节困难、多种肌肉骨骼问题,还有一次癫痫大发作病史。患者2,10岁,有轻度畸形特征、治疗抵抗性呕吐且胃动力减弱、轻度便秘、皮质性视力障碍伴间歇性斜视、轴性肌张力减退、体温调节困难,以及皮肤肥大细胞增多症。基因检测在患者1中鉴定出KIAA2022变异c.652C>T(p.Arg218*),在患者2中鉴定出一个新的无义新生变异c.2707G>T(p.Glu903*)。我们还总结了迄今为止所有报道的携带KIAA2022变异的男性的特征。本报告不仅为KIAA2022变异数据库增添了一种新的致病变异的知识,还可能通过描述新的畸形特征和医学状况(包括巨舌、咖啡斑、圆锥角膜、严重皮肤肥大细胞增多症以及胃肠道动力问题)来扩展疾病谱,这可能有助于照料该综合征患者的医生。最后,我们描述了社交媒体在将患有罕见疾病的家庭聚集在一起方面的作用。
